Why "Mufasa: The Lion King" is a Must-Watch in 2024 Directed by Academy Award winner Barry Jenkins, this film serves as both a prequel and a sequel to the 2019 photorealistic remake. It moves away from the traditional "born to rule" narrative to show Mufasa as an orphaned cub who finds his place in the "Circle of Life" through resilience and unexpected brotherhood. Epic Origin Story : Learn how an orphaned cub became the "unimpeachably great" king we know, and the roots of his complex relationship with his brother, Taka (later known as Scar). Star-Studded Hindi Dub : The Hindi version is a massive draw for Indian audiences, featuring Shah Rukh Khan as the voice of Mufasa, with his sons Aryan Khan voicing Simba and AbRam Khan voicing young Mufasa. Stunning Visuals : The film continues the photorealistic animation style that brought the African savannah to life in 2019, now with even more expansive landscapes and new territories like the Valley of the Kings. 2. Film Synopsis The story is told in a flashback framework by Rafiki to Kiara (Simba’s daughter). It follows an orphaned cub named Mufasa who is lost and alone until he meets a sympathetic lion prince, Taka. The two become close as brothers, but their bond is tested when a lethal threat approaches their kingdom. The narrative serves as a tragic origin story, explaining how Mufasa became king and how Taka became the jealous Scar.
3. Critical Analysis of the Movie A. Direction and Cinematography Moving from Jon Favreau to Barry Jenkins (director of Moonlight ) was a bold shift. Jenkins brings a more intimate, character-driven focus compared to the 2019 film. The visuals are stunning—arguably the "best" in live-action/CGI hybrid history. The lighting, fur textures, and landscapes are photorealistic. B. Music Composed by Lin-Manuel Miranda , the soundtrack has big shoes to fill following Elton John and Hans Zimmer. While it may not have an instant classic like "Circle of Life," songs like "I Always Wanted a Brother" are catchy and emotionally resonant. C. Performance (Voice Cast)
Original (English): Aaron Pierre (Mufasa) and Kelvin Harrison Jr. (Taka) deliver powerful, grounded performances.
